Chapter 150 Love Token
In the magnificent hall, Ji Wuyuan sat alone in front of the imperial desk, his eyes fixed on the crabapple hairpin in the wooden box. His eyes were gloomy and his expression was cold.
He narrowed his eyes slightly, his gaze cold and gloomy, and fixed them on Wang Fuhai standing beside him: "Did the person who sent this thing say anything else?"
Wang Fuhai knelt on the ground in fear, trembling all over, and stammered, "Your Majesty, that person said... this is the... the token of love between the Imperial Concubine and Young Marquis Xiao..."
In just a moment, the temperature in the hall dropped instantly, and the air seemed to solidify.
Ji Wuyuan's eyes instantly turned cold and cruel, his fingers tightly gripped the edge of the imperial desk, his knuckles turning white.
After a long time, he raised his hand and picked up the crabapple hairpin in the wooden box. The crabapple flowers on the hairpin were carved vividly. If you look carefully from the side, you can see the small "Tang" characters under each petal.
It is undoubtedly a token of love.
The osmanthus candy wrapped in oil paper lay quietly aside, emitting a faint sweet fragrance of osmanthus.
Ji Wuyuan narrowed his eyes, and a dangerous light flashed in his eyes.
In the dead silence, a very light "tsk" sound suddenly rang out from the hall: "What a token of love."
A very familiar voice with a smile on its face, this was a sign of anger and the intention to kill.
Wang Fuhai knelt on the ground tremblingly, trying his best to reduce his presence.
Sure enough, the next moment, Ji Wuyuan's sharp voice was heard: "Who delivered the things?"
Wang Fuhai said, "A young eunuch guarding the palace gate."
"Kill him." Ji Wuyuan said coldly.
"Yes."
Wang Fuhai was so terrified that his back was soaked with sweat.
Then, Ji Wuyuan asked again: "Can you find out who sent this thing?"
Wang Fuhai leaned down even lower and stammered, "It's...it's the Imperial Concubine's elder sister, the eldest daughter of the Jiang family, Jiang Wanfu."
Who could have imagined that this woman, who was once the most beautiful woman in the capital with both talent and beauty, is now so dissolute that she not only keeps young prostitutes outside, but is also divorced by her husband and sent back to her parents' home.
When His Majesty was holding the general election, she was supposed to be the Jiang family's legitimate daughter on the original list.
The second young lady, who was far away in the countryside, suddenly returned to Beijing and entered the palace in place of her elder sister. Any discerning person could see that there was something wrong between them.
It would be better if my sister was not favored, and we could all live in peace.
But it just so happens that this second young lady has been deeply favored by His Majesty since she entered the palace, just like Gao Ge, and has risen rapidly.
Just as the younger sister was conferred the title of Imperial Concubine, the elder sister came up with evil ideas to sabotage her.
Oh, what a terrible thing this is!
"Jiang family?" Ji Wuyuan sneered and muttered these two words.
"Go and bring someone over to replace Gu Chuan." Ji Wuyuan spoke lightly, but the next sentence he said was terrifying: "...Xiao Jingheng."
Is this a call for severe punishment or face-to-face confrontation?
The incident with Concubine Qi just happened, and now the newly appointed Concubine Yu is about to get into trouble again...
None of the women in this harem are quiet.
"Your Majesty..." Wang Fuhai raised his head hastily, with panic still on his face.
He wanted to say that Xiao Jingheng was the only son of the Pingyang Marquis's family, so it was not appropriate to kill him at will.
"What?" Ji Wuyuan snorted coldly, his tone suddenly turned cold, his eyes narrowed slightly, and he said coldly: "Don't you understand what I said?"
Wang Fuhai didn't dare to delay, he quickly stood up, apologized and walked out.
Not long after, the leader of the secret guards entered the palace and reported, "Your Majesty, I have discovered that the Imperial Concubine and Young Marquis Xiao did have some interactions in the past, but they were not many."
"Young Marquis Xiao and the eldest daughter of the Jiang family were childhood sweethearts, and they had a deep affection for each other. Before their wedding, Young Marquis Xiao had spent many days wandering outside the Prime Minister's residence. But for unknown reasons, on the day of his wedding, he abandoned his new wife and rode to the palace gates, where he intercepted the Imperial Concubine who was entering the palace for the selection."
"The two of them had a brief conversation that lasted less than a cup of tea, and the Imperial Concubine did not show up at all."
"..."
"..."
Later, the secret guard also reported the general situation after Xiao Jingheng and Jiang Wanfu got married, from the two of them getting divorced, Jiang Wanfu not being a good wife and keeping a mistress outside, to Jiang Zhixu being demoted, the Jiang family falling into decline, and Xiao Jingheng divorcing his wife...
Ji Wuyuan already had a fierce aura, and at this moment, with a gloomy face and without saying a word, he looked even more imposing.
He lowered his eyes to look at the crabapple hairpin in the wooden box, the look in his eyes dark and unclear.
The content of the secret guard leader's report was exactly the same as what he had found out last time, but he had a hunch that the relationship between the two was not that simple.
Judging from this crabapple flower hairpin alone, it is clear that the man has feelings for her, and they are not shallow...
Thinking of this, a bloodthirsty red suddenly appeared in the corners of Ji Wuyuan's eyes.
He asked himself: Am I angry?
Of course I was angry, so angry that I wanted to kill someone.
All his confidence and self-assurance, the game between the emperor and his favorite concubine that he thought he had won, eventually became vulnerable as he became more and more addicted to Jiang Wantang day after day.
He couldn't be sure whether Jiang Wantang really had him in her heart.
But even if he is not there, there can be no one else.
If someone he likes, he will think that they are coveting him even if others look at them for a second.
Anyone who dares to covet him is seeking death.
In less than half an hour, Xiao Jingheng, dressed in a deep blue robe and handsome, walked in.
Xiao Jingheng walked to the main hall and knelt down to salute: "Your Majesty, I pay my respects to you. Long live Your Majesty!"
Ji Wuyuan looked coldly at Xiao Jingheng who was kneeling in the hall with dignity. This was the first time he looked at him straight in the eye, and his eyes unconsciously carried a bit of coldness.
He bent his fingers and tapped the table with his fingertips, making a dull sound, without any intention of waking him up.
As I watched, I began to secretly compete with myself in my heart.
Well... he is good-looking, but far inferior to Gu;
Tsk…this skinny body is not as good as Gu’s;
……
After a comparison, Xiao Jingheng is inferior to him in every aspect.
Ji Wuyuan's eyes were filled with sarcasm and disdain, which he did not conceal at all.
You are inferior to me in every way, and yet you dare to covet my woman?
Do not overestimate your own capabilities.
The atmosphere in the hall instantly became cold as soon as Xiao Jingheng entered. It was the invisibly oppressive aura that Ji Wuyuan released towards him.
However, Xiao Jingheng knelt straight, without any dissatisfaction or timidity.
After a long moment, Ji Wuyuan raised his eyelids, his expression cold yet dignified: "I didn't know that Young Marquis Xiao was such a sentimental person..."
"He married his childhood sweetheart's elder sister, but he was thinking about her younger sister."
Xiao Jingheng's pupils shrank sharply, his heart sank, and then alarm bells rang in his mind.
Your Majesty, do you know everything?
How's Tang'er? Is she okay?
Thinking of this, his heart tightened instantly, and he felt uneasy. However, he pretended to be calm and said, "I don't know what your majesty means."
"But how did I offend Your Majesty?"
Just as he finished speaking, a wooden box hit his forehead hard, and a large amount of blood flowed out, flowing down his face to his body and the hall.
However, Xiao Jingheng no longer cared about anything else. All his eyes and thoughts fell on the crabapple flower hairpin that fell to the ground...
